Transaction 657056f9a59a8f6cacde84453dd15bcd1cecaf8760c7455064590e5133a453e8

1 Input
2 Outputs
  • 657056f9a59a8f6cacde84453dd15bcd1cecaf8760c7455064590e5133a453e8:0
  • value  932200
    address  18YoDQJY4AXe3UkonuWyN9xKaPCcTaLQvM
  • 657056f9a59a8f6cacde84453dd15bcd1cecaf8760c7455064590e5133a453e8:1
  • value  15932188
    address  1KwwBfiQxyvHGqxKetZ4ogzjiDiEHafTdY